Mesh Specification
- Mesh Count = 16 holes per linear inch. The amount of holes measured against a straight line inch
- Holes / Wires Per Square Inch = 256 holes per square inch. The amount of holes per linear inch squared
- Wire Thickness = 0.355mm. The thickness of each wire. The structure is thicker than this where two wires meet
- Hole Size / Aperture = 1.23mm. This is the square hole size from wire to wire
- Open Area % = 60%. The amount of the mesh that is open. The higher this number the more open a mesh is. This is a very high open area%
- Cut With – We cut this mesh with tin snips. We suggest that you do the same

FAQs For This Fly Screen Mesh
Do Fly Screens Work?
Yes, fly screens work very effectively to keep out insects and other small animals while still allowing fresh air and light to flow through windows and doors. The mesh used in fly screens is tightly woven to block entry to insects, while still allowing air to circulate freely.
Fly screens can help to prevent common insects such as mosquitoes, flies, and wasps from entering homes and other buildings. This can help to reduce the risk of insect-borne diseases, as well as prevent annoying insect bites and stings.
While fly screens are not completely impenetrable and may not stop very small insects such as gnats, they are highly effective at keeping out larger insects such as flies and mosquitoes.
Why Choose Galvanised Steel Fly Screen Mesh?
Galvanised steel fly screen mesh is a popular choice for making fly screens because it is strong, durable, and resistant to rust and corrosion. The steel wire used in the mesh is coated with a layer of zinc, which provides protection against rust and corrosion, making it ideal for use in outdoor environments or areas with high humidity.
Galvanised steel fly screen mesh is also strong enough to withstand damage from pets and other animals, as well as provide a good barrier against larger insects such as wasps and bees.
In addition to its strength and durability, galvanised steel fly screen mesh is also relatively easy to maintain and clean. It can be cleaned with soap and water, and is resistant to damage from UV radiation and exposure to the elements.
How Long Should It Last?
The lifespan of galvanised steel fly screen mesh can vary depending on a number of factors, including the quality of the mesh, the environment in which it is used, and how well it is maintained. However, in general, galvanised steel fly screen mesh is known for its durability and can last for many years with proper care.
Galvanised steel fly screen mesh is resistant to rust and corrosion, which helps to extend its lifespan, even in harsh outdoor environments. However, it is still important to clean and maintain the mesh regularly to ensure that it continues to function properly.
